The basic unit of computer internal data processing is
The basic unit of computer processing data is data element.

Data element is a computer science term. It is the basic unit of data, and data elements are also called nodes or records. It is usually considered and processed as a whole in a computer program.

Sometimes, a data element can be composed of several data items, for example, the bibliographic information of a book is a data element, and each bibliographic information (such as book title, author name, etc.). ) is a data item. A data item is the smallest indivisible unit of data.

Data elements are composed of object classes, features and representations, in which object classes are used to collect and store data, such as people, wells, cores, pipelines and storage tanks. Features are used to distinguish and describe objects, such as color, gender, age, income, address and price.

The most important aspect of data representation is range, which is the set of allowable values of data elements. For ranges, there are two types of ranges in data elements. One is that the value is fixed, that is, the value is enumerable, such as the data element of human eye color.

Basic theory:

1. data element: it is the basic unit of data and consists of data items. Under different conditions, data elements can also be called elements, nodes, vertices, records and so on. A data element is a data unit that defines, identifies, represents and allows values with a set of attributes.

2. Data element value/metadata: the value in the allowable value set of a data element.

3. Data item: A data item is the smallest identification unit with independent meaning, the specific value of a data element, and the most basic and inseparable well-known data unit in data records.

4. Synonymous name: the concept of data elements that are different from the given name but represent the same.
